How It Works: Building a Research Question
The most important step in research is crafting a strong question. A question that is too broad will overwhelm you with information. A question that is too narrow might not have enough sources. The sweet spot is a focused question (a question that is specific enough to research in a short project but open enough to explore from different angles).
The Question Funnel
Think of building a research question like using a funnel. You start with a broad topic at the top and narrow it down until you have a focused question at the bottom.
| Level | Example | Problem |
|---|---|---|
| Too Broad | What is climate change? | Millions of results. You could write a whole book! |
| Getting Closer | How does climate change affect animals? | Still broad—thousands of animals exist. |
| Just Right | How is climate change affecting polar bear populations in the Arctic? | Specific, researchable, and allows follow-up questions. |
| Too Narrow | How many polar bears lived in Svalbard in 2019? | This is a single fact, not a research project. |
Generating Follow-Up Questions
Once you begin reading sources, your brain will naturally wonder about new things. Write those wonders down! These become your follow-up questions. Good follow-up questions often start with words like why, how, what if, and what else.
- Original question: How is climate change affecting polar bear populations in the Arctic?
- Follow-up 1: What specific changes in sea ice are making it harder for polar bears to hunt?
- Follow-up 2: Are conservation programs helping, and if so, which ones?
- Follow-up 3: How might the decline of polar bears affect other Arctic species?
Each follow-up question opens a new avenue of exploration. Follow-up 1 takes you into environmental science. Follow-up 2 leads you into conservation policy. Follow-up 3 explores ecology. That is the power of good questions—they multiply and deepen your understanding.
Finding and Evaluating Sources
A research project is only as strong as its sources. But not every website, book, or video is trustworthy. In this section, you will learn how to identify different types of sources and evaluate whether they are reliable.
The CRAAP Test for Evaluating Sources
One popular way to evaluate a source is the CRAAP Test (a checklist that stands for Currency, Relevance, Authority, Accuracy, and Purpose). Ask these five questions about every source you use.
- Currency: When was this published or updated? Is it recent enough for my topic?
- Relevance: Does this source actually answer my research question?
- Authority: Who is the author? Are they an expert in this field?
- Accuracy: Is the information backed by evidence? Can I verify it in another source?
- Purpose: Why was this written? Is it meant to inform, sell something, or persuade?

Strengths and Common Pitfalls of Research Projects
Even strong researchers make mistakes sometimes. Knowing the common pitfalls ahead of time will help you avoid them. The table below compares good research habits with mistakes to watch out for.
| Good Research Habit | Common Pitfall | How to Fix It |
|---|---|---|
| Uses 3 or more sources | Only uses one website | Search in a library database, not just Google |
| Asks focused follow-up questions | Stops after answering the first question | Write 'I wonder...' notes as you read each source |
| Evaluates sources for reliability | Trusts every search result equally | Use the CRAAP test on every source |
| Paraphrases and cites sources | Copies and pastes from websites | Put information in your own words and list where you found it |
| Explores multiple angles | Only looks at one side of an issue | Deliberately search for different viewpoints |
Connection to Advanced Research Skills
The skills you are learning now—asking questions, using multiple sources, and generating follow-ups—are the same skills used by college students, journalists, scientists, and professionals. As you grow as a researcher, the projects get longer and the sources get more complex, but the process stays the same.
| Skill | 8th Grade (CCSS.W.8.7) | High School & Beyond |
|---|---|---|
| Research Question | Self-generated, focused question on a manageable topic | Thesis-driven questions that require argument and analysis |
| Sources | Several sources (3–5), including books, websites, and articles | 10+ sources, including primary documents and peer-reviewed journals |
| Follow-Up Questions | Generate related, focused questions that allow multiple avenues | Develop a full annotated bibliography and literature review |
| Final Product | Short research report or presentation | Research papers, capstone projects, or published articles |

Lesson Summary
In this lesson, you learned how to conduct a short research project from start to finish. Every project begins with a focused research question that is specific enough to be manageable but open enough to explore. You use the Question Funnel to narrow a broad topic into a great question. Then you search for multiple sources and evaluate them using the CRAAP test (Currency, Relevance, Authority, Accuracy, Purpose).
As you read and take notes, you naturally discover new curiosities. These become your follow-up questions, and each one opens a new avenue of exploration. The research cycle is a loop, not a straight line—you ask, search, evaluate, question, and search again. Remember to use sources with different viewpoints, put information in your own words, and keep asking "What else do I want to know?" These skills will serve you well in every class and every career.
